Description. y = bandstop (x,wpass) filters the input signal x using a bandstop filter with a stopband frequency range specified by the two-element vector wpass and expressed in normalized units of π rad/sample. bandstop uses a minimum-order filter with a stopband attenuation of 60 dB and compensates for the delay introduced by the filter. Band-pass filtering by Difference of Gaussians. #. Band-pass filters attenuate signal frequencies outside of a range (band) of interest. In image analysis, they can be used to denoise images while at the same time reducing low-frequency artifacts such a uneven illumination. Bandreject filters (or notches) are used to pass a large operating band of frequencies, while rejecting a narrow band of frequencies. This band of frequencies may have a 3 dB bandwidth as small as 0.5% or as large as 30 or 40%. The band reject filter is designed for each customer’s specific frequency applications.

The BANDREJECT_FILTER function applies a low-reject, high-reject, or band-reject filter on a one-channel image. A band reject filter is useful when the general location of the noise in the frequency domain is known. A band reject filter blocks frequencies within the chosen range and lets frequencies outside of the range pass through. The filter attenuates the specific band. The filter has several applications. For example, a band-stop filter is designed to reject frequencies between 2.5 GHz to 3.5 GHz. The filter will allow frequency components lower than 2.5 GHz and above 3.5 GHz.
